sameer s said:
impliment rotate thru carry instruction in C language Why do you want to do that? The whole point of writing in a high-level language (eg, 'C') is to avoid needing to think of the details of specific CPU registers, instructions, etc - you should be concentrating on what you want to achieve, rather than how the CPU will implement it. So, what is it that you are actually trying to achieve? |
